Recent discussions on Reddit have brought attention to whether virtual reality (VR) can be sustainable if it relies heavily on mods created by users. This debate highlights concerns about long-term support, stability, and the future of VR ecosystems, making it a key question for industry stakeholders and consumers alike.

On r/virtualreality, users have expressed mixed opinions about the reliance on mods to extend VR content and functionality. Some argue that mods are essential for maintaining interest and expanding capabilities, especially as official content may lag behind user demand. Others warn that dependence on mods could undermine the sustainability of VR platforms, citing issues such as inconsistent quality, security vulnerabilities, and the risk of fragmented ecosystems.

There is no official stance from major VR hardware or software companies confirming that they intend to rely on mods for future development. Industry experts acknowledge that mods have historically played a role in PC gaming’s longevity, but caution that VR’s hardware and software ecosystems face unique challenges that may limit the long-term viability of a mod-dependent model.

Current discussions are primarily anecdotal and speculative, with no concrete data or official policies indicating a shift toward or away from mod reliance in VR development.

01 · Why mods matter

A powerful extension layer

PC gaming shows that modding can revive aging titles and sustain communities. VR gains similar benefits, but its tighter connection between software, sensors, motion controls, comfort, and physical safety raises the cost of failure.

Longevity

More life for existing titles

New maps, mechanics, conversions, and quality-of-life improvements can keep users engaged long after official releases slow down.

Innovation

Experiments at community speed

Creators can test niche interactions and accessibility ideas without waiting for a platform holder’s product roadmap.

Adaptation

Hardware stays useful longer

Compatibility fixes and added features may extend device relevance—provided updates do not repeatedly break those additions.

02 · Sustainability test

Helpful layer or critical dependency?

The central distinction is whether mods complement a healthy platform or compensate for missing official investment. The more essential they become, the more volunteer availability and unofficial maintenance turn into systemic risks.

Editorial assessment Mods are best treated as leverage—not infrastructure.

A durable VR ecosystem needs supported content, stable interfaces, security processes, and hardware compatibility beneath its community layer.

05 · Key questions

What the debate can—and cannot—answer

No major platform policy currently demonstrates that VR intends to rely on mods as its core development model. The most defensible conclusion remains conditional.

Question 01

Can VR survive without mods?

Yes. Sustainability can come from official content, developer investment, services, and dependable platform support. Mods are valuable, but not inherently required.

Question 02

Could mods extend hardware life?

Potentially. New functions and compatibility fixes can preserve relevance, although unsupported software can also become brittle after platform updates.

Question 03

Are VR companies actively supporting mods?

Support remains uneven and generally more limited than in traditional PC gaming. Policies, tooling, and distribution paths vary by platform and title.

Question 04

What are the central risks?

Security vulnerabilities, inconsistent quality, fragmented communities, update breakage, intellectual-property disputes, and moderation burdens.

Question 05

What would make modding sustainable?

Stable APIs, permission controls, versioning, trusted distribution, safety review, creator documentation, update guarantees, and an official content baseline.

Role of Mods in VR Development and Community Engagement

Historically, mods have played a significant role in PC gaming, often revitalizing titles and fostering active communities. In VR, mods are increasingly used to customize experiences, add features, and extend hardware capabilities. However, unlike traditional gaming, VR ecosystems involve complex hardware-software integration, raising questions about how well mods can be managed without compromising stability or security.

Recent years have seen a rise in user-generated VR content, but official support for mods remains limited compared to PC gaming. The debate on Reddit reflects broader concerns about whether this trend can be scaled into a sustainable model for VR development.
